Whenever you have to simplify a radical expression, the first step you should take is to determine … WebAug 2, 2015 · Algebra Radicals and Geometry Connections Simplification of Radical Expressions 1 Answer Eric Sandin Aug 2, 2015 Express 30 in product of powers of exponent 2, and extract those. Explanation: Since 30 = 2 ⋅ 3 ⋅ 5 you cannot simplify √30, you could just express it like: √30 = √2 ⋅ √3 ⋅ √5 Answer link sims 4 lip gloss holographic https://amythill.com

WebThe same process works for variables under the radical. Let's start off from the basics again. √x2=x. x⋅x=x2, so √x2 can be simplified into x. You can multiply different variables under the radical to simplify. √x2y4z. First we're gonna separate the radical into parts to make it easier to work with, then we can simplify the parts. You just … WebSep 1, 2024 · Simplify each radical expression. Add or subtract expressions with equal radicands. Example 1.3.8: Adding Square Roots Add 5√12 + 2√3. Solution We can rewrite 5√12 as 5√4 × 3. According the product rule, this becomes 5√4√3. The square root of √4 is 2, so the expression becomes 5 × 2√3, which is 10√3.

WebFeb 25, 2024 · To simplify radical expressions, we will also use some properties of roots. The properties we will use to simplify radical expressions are similar to the properties of exponents. We know that (ab)n = anbn. The corresponding of Product Property of Roots says that n√ab = n√a ⋅ n√b. Definition 4.2.2: Product Property of nth Roots
